H A D | log_overlay.cpp | 50 overlay_put_vnode(fs_volume *volume, fs_vnode *vnode, bool reenter) argument 68 overlay_remove_vnode(fs_volume *volume, fs_vnode *vnode, bool reenter) argument 86 overlay_get_super_vnode(fs_volume *volume, fs_vnode *vnode, argument 106 overlay_lookup(fs_volume *volume, fs_vnod argument 116 overlay_get_vnode_name(fs_volume *volume, fs_vnode *vnode, char *buffer, size_t bufferSize) argument 129 overlay_can_page(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 145 overlay_read_pages(fs_volume *volume, fs_vnode *vnode, void *cookie, off_t pos, const iovec *vecs, size_t count, size_t *numBytes) argument 159 overlay_write_pages(fs_volume *volume, fs_vnode *vnode, void *cookie, off_t pos, const iovec *vecs, size_t count, size_t *numBytes) argument 173 overlay_io(fs_volume *volume, fs_vnode *vnode, void *cookie, io_request *request) argument 187 overlay_cancel_io(fs_volume *volume, fs_vnode *vnode, void *cookie, io_request *request) argument 198 overlay_get_file_map(fs_volume *volume, fs_vnode *vnode, off_t offset, size_t size, struct file_io_vec *vecs, size_t *count) argument 211 overlay_ioctl(fs_volume *volume, fs_vnode *vnode, void *cookie, uint32 op, void *buffer, size_t length) argument 223 overlay_set_flags(fs_volume *volume, fs_vnode *vnode, void *cookie, int flags) argument 234 overlay_select(fs_volume *volume, fs_vnode *vnode, void *cookie, uint8 event, selectsync *sync) argument 246 overlay_deselect(fs_volume *volume, fs_vnode *vnode, void *cookie, uint8 event, selectsync *sync) argument 258 overlay_fsync(fs_volume *volume, fs_vnode *vnode) argument 273 overlay_read_symlink(fs_volume *volume, fs_vnode *vnode, char *buffer, size_t *bufferSize) argument 288 overlay_create_symlink(fs_volume *volume, fs_vnode *vnode, const char *name, const char *path, int mode) argument 300 overlay_link(fs_volume *volume, fs_vnode *vnode, const char *name, fs_vnode *target) argument 312 overlay_unlink(fs_volume *volume, fs_vnode *vnode, const char *name) argument 322 overlay_rename(fs_volume *volume, fs_vnode *vnode, const char *fromName, fs_vnode *toDir, const char *toName) argument 334 overlay_access(fs_volume *volume, fs_vnode *vnode, int mode) argument 344 overlay_read_stat(fs_volume *volume, fs_vnode *vnode, struct stat *stat) argument 360 overlay_write_stat(fs_volume *volume, fs_vnode *vnode, const struct stat *stat, uint32 statMask) argument 371 overlay_create(fs_volume *volume, fs_vnode *vnode, const char *name, int openMode, int perms, void **cookie, ino_t *newVnodeID) argument 384 overlay_open(fs_volume *volume, fs_vnode *vnode, int openMode, void **cookie) argument 394 overlay_close(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 404 overlay_free_cookie(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 414 overlay_read(fs_volume *volume, fs_vnode *vnode, void *cookie, off_t pos, void *buffer, size_t *length) argument 427 overlay_write(fs_volume *volume, fs_vnode *vnode, void *cookie, off_t pos, const void *buffer, size_t *length) argument 440 overlay_create_dir(fs_volume *volume, fs_vnode *vnode, const char *name, int perms) argument 451 overlay_remove_dir(fs_volume *volume, fs_vnode *vnode, const char *name) argument 461 overlay_open_dir(fs_volume *volume, fs_vnode *vnode, void **cookie) argument 471 overlay_close_dir(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 481 overlay_free_dir_cookie(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 491 overlay_read_dir(fs_volume *volume, fs_vnode *vnode, void *cookie, struct dirent *buffer, size_t bufferSize, uint32 *num) argument 504 overlay_rewind_dir(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 514 overlay_open_attr_dir(fs_volume *volume, fs_vnode *vnode, void **cookie) argument 525 overlay_close_attr_dir(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 535 overlay_free_attr_dir_cookie(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 545 overlay_read_attr_dir(fs_volume *volume, fs_vnode *vnode, void *cookie, struct dirent *buffer, size_t bufferSize, uint32 *num) argument 558 overlay_rewind_attr_dir(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 568 overlay_create_attr(fs_volume *volume, fs_vnode *vnode, const char *name, uint32 type, int openMode, void **cookie) argument 580 overlay_open_attr(fs_volume *volume, fs_vnode *vnode, const char *name, int openMode, void **cookie) argument 591 overlay_close_attr(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 601 overlay_free_attr_cookie(fs_volume *volume, fs_vnode *vnode, void *cookie) argument 611 overlay_read_attr(fs_volume *volume, fs_vnode *vnode, void *cookie, off_t pos, void *buffer, size_t *length) argument 624 overlay_write_attr(fs_volume *volume, fs_vnode *vnode, void *cookie, off_t pos, const void *buffer, size_t *length) argument 637 overlay_read_attr_stat(fs_volume *volume, fs_vnode *vnode, void *cookie, struct stat *stat) argument 655 overlay_write_attr_stat(fs_volume *volume, fs_vnode *vnode, void *cookie, const struct stat *stat, int statMask) argument 667 overlay_rename_attr(fs_volume *volume, fs_vnode *vnode, const char *fromName, fs_vnode *toVnode, const char *toName) argument 680 overlay_remove_attr(fs_volume *volume, fs_vnode *vnode, const char *name) argument 690 overlay_create_special_node(fs_volume *volume, fs_vnode *vnode, const char *name, fs_vnode *subVnode, mode_t mode, uint32 flags, fs_vnode *_superVnode, ino_t *nodeID) argument 805 overlay_unmount(fs_volume *volume) argument 818 overlay_read_fs_info(fs_volume *volume, struct fs_info *info) argument 836 overlay_write_fs_info(fs_volume *volume, const struct fs_info *info, uint32 mask) argument 847 overlay_sync(fs_volume *volume) argument 859 overlay_get_vnode(fs_volume *volume, ino_t id, fs_vnode *vnode, int *type, uint32 *flags, bool reenter) argument 895 overlay_open_index_dir(fs_volume *volume, void **cookie) argument 906 overlay_close_index_dir(fs_volume *volume, void *cookie) argument 916 overlay_free_index_dir_cookie(fs_volume *volume, void *cookie) argument 926 overlay_read_index_dir(fs_volume *volume, void *cookie, struct dirent *buffer, size_t bufferSize, uint32 *num) argument 939 overlay_rewind_index_dir(fs_volume *volume, void *cookie) argument 949 overlay_create_index(fs_volume *volume, const char *name, uint32 type, uint32 flags) argument 961 overlay_remove_index(fs_volume *volume, const char *name) argument 971 overlay_read_index_stat(fs_volume *volume, const char *name, struct stat *stat) argument 988 overlay_open_query(fs_volume *volume, const char *query, uint32 flags, port_id port, uint32 token, void **cookie) argument 1001 overlay_close_query(fs_volume *volume, void *cookie) argument 1011 overlay_free_query_cookie(fs_volume *volume, void *cookie) argument 1021 overlay_read_query(fs_volume *volume, void *cookie, struct dirent *buffer, size_t bufferSize, uint32 *num) argument 1034 overlay_rewind_query(fs_volume *volume, void *cookie) argument 1044 overlay_all_layers_mounted(fs_volume *volume) argument 1051 overlay_create_sub_vnode(fs_volume *volume, ino_t id, fs_vnode *vnode) argument 1065 overlay_delete_sub_vnode(fs_volume *volume, fs_vnode *vnode) argument 1106 overlay_mount(fs_volume *volume, const char *device, uint32 flags, const char *args, ino_t *rootID) argument [all...] |